Filming for the new series of Morecambe based crime drama, The Bay, is set to get underway soon, as first glimpses of scripts were revealed today.
Series 4 of the popular ITV show is set to air sometime in 2023, and creator, Daragh Carville, has got fans excited as he shared a photo of the front cover of the script of episode one of the new series to fans on social media.

Series 3 ended in February, with the third season based around the death of aspiring boxer, whose body was found in the sea near at Half Moon Bay at Heysham in the first episode.
The last series saw actress Marsha Thomason join as Morecambe CID’s new Family Liaison Officer, DS Jenn Townsend, alongside regulars Daniel Ryan, Erin Shanagher, Thomas Law and Andrew Dowbiggin.
The drama has previously used many prime locations across North Lancashire, including Morecambe Prom, Queen Street, Hest Bank, Heysham Port, and the outside of Morecambe Police Station.
The closing episode of series 3 also featured scenes shot at the White Cross pub in Lancaster.
Meanwhile The Bay has been nominated for three TV Choice awards including Best drama series, with Dan Ryan up for Best actor and Marsha Thomason up for Best actress.
Tall Story Pictures, the production company who make the show, Tweeted: ‘’YAY! The Bay is up for a TV Choice Award. Lovely news to receive just before we start filming the new series.’’
At the end of series 3, they posted: ‘’We are thrilled to be returning to Morecambe for another series. Huge thanks to the fantastic cast & crew of series 3, and to all who watched this year - a massive massive thank you. We’ll be back on ITV next year.’’
